The annual salary statistics of maids and housekeeping cleaners in Railbelt-Southwest Alaska nonmetropolitan area, Alaska is shown in Table 1. The wage information of maids and housekeeping cleaners in Railbelt-Southwest Alaska nonmetropolitan area is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
|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
|---|---|
| 10th Percentile Wage | $21,850 |
| 25th Percentile Wage | $23,440 |
| 50th Percentile Wage | $26,860 |
| 75th Percentile Wage | $32,010 |
| 90th Percentile Wage | $38,030 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for maids and housekeeping cleaners in Railbelt-Southwest Alaska nonmetropolitan area, Alaska in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$38,030.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$26,860.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$21,850.
